Maritime Health fitness certificate of Assa’adah Medical Centre is neither a certificate of general health nor a certification of the absence of illness. It is a confirmation that the seafarer / offshore crew:
• Have the physical capability to fulfill all the requirements of basic training as required by Section A-VI/1 of STCW;
• Demonstrate adequate vision and hearing to detect any visual and audible alarms;
• Is expected to be able to meet the minimum requirements for performing the routine and emergency duties specific to their post at sea safely and effectively during the period of validity of the health fitness certificate.
